An Analysis of the Functional Mechanisms of Endostatin : The Anti-angiogenic Activity of Endostatin Is Mediated by Its Multiple Binding Ability

Endostatin, an endogenous angiogenesis inhibitor derived from type XVIII collagen, is highly promising as part of cancer therapy. Endostatin shows a multi-binding ability to tropomyosin, heparin, perlecan, glypican. integrin, zinc, laminin, and fibulin. Among these, integrin and glypican are considered to be functional receptors of endostatin, although their binding affinities arc low to moderate. The enzymatic activity of matrix metalloproteinases is inhibited by endostatin, which binds to their catalytic domains. The anti-tumor activity of endostatin is mediated not only by its anti-angiogenic activity, but also manifests itself in its direct effect on tumor cells. Despite the many studies published on endostatin, its mechanisms seem to be complicated and still remain to be elucidated. The possibility of substituting synthetic peptides for endostatin is also introduced and discussed.
